INTRODUCTION
This report presents a summary of geotechnical observations and testing conducted on the site during
the rough grading and construction phases. The general contractor for the project was Diversified
Construction and the grading contractor was Burt Simms Grading. Geotechnical observation and
testing was conducted on an on-call basis for documented aspects of the project from July 18, 2007
through March 23, 2009.
GEOTECHNICAL CONDITIONS
The property is underlain at relatively shallow depths by poorly consolidated Pleistocene terrace
deposits that are correlated with the Bay Point formation on published geologic maps. The terrace
deposits are underlain at depth by Eocene-age sedimentary rocks which have commonly been
designated as the Santiago Formation on published geologic maps. The terrace deposits are covered
by thin residual soil and minor fill deposits. These surficial deposits were removed or recompacted
during the grading and construction phases on most of the site
PROJECT SUMMARY
The project included excavation of a subterranean garage up to 13.5 feet bçlow existing grade.
Temporary slopes were constructed at a gradient of 3/4:1 (horizontal to vertical) or less, as discussed
in the referenced reports. Survey points were established on the existing property line retaining wall
by BHA, project civil engineering firm, in the northeastern portion of the site. Subsequent surveying

The upper 2.0 feet to 3.0 feet of the Pleistocene terrace deposits'. exposed along the garage subgrade
were removed and replaced as compacted fill. Density test results, as well as a general discussion
of the grading operations are addressed in the referenced Rough Grading Report, dated August 23,
2007.
The storm drain system was subsequently constructed along the garage subgrade. The excavated
granular deposits were used as trench backfill above the 3/4 inch rock bedding. The backfill was
placed in 8.0 inch lifts, moistened as required to near optimum moisture content, and compacted with
a sheepsfoot attached to a tractor-mounted backhoe and hand operated compaction equipment.
Selective testing suggests the backfill deposits were compacted to a minimum of 90 percent of the
laboratory maximum dry density. The results of the laboratory testing and field density tests are
plotted on the enclosed grading plan, prepared by BHA, Land Planning and Civil Engineering.
Upon completion of storm drain trench backfill, the footings for the proposed garage walls and
column pads were excavated in the lower garage pad. The footing excavations along the lower
garage pad were observed by this firm, as documented in the various footing excavation observation
reports referenced in this report.

A limited amount, approximately 2.0 feet, of garage wall backfill was placed prior to construction
of the first floor post-tensioned slab, as per suggestions of Collons+Smith, project structural
engineers. Upon completion of the post-tensioned slab, the wall backfill was continued. Backfill
was placed in loose lifts of approximately 8.0 inches, moistened to near optimum moisture and
compacted. Compaction was accomplished with a Bobcat and hand operated compaction equipment.
The lower 10± feet of wall backfill was tested by this firm, however, the upper 3.0 feet of wall
backfill was not tested per the request of the owner. The completion of a wall backfill report by this
office was declined by the owner. Density testing along the lower wall backfill deposits suggests
the backfill was compacted to a minimum of 90 percent of the laboratory maximum.
Additional utility line backfill testing was conducted along Date Street, per the request of the city
of Carlsbad. Testing included the sewer, line, storm drain, water line and gas/electric line
connections along Date Street. It should be noted that some of the utility line backfill testing was
limited to subgrades only, as requested by the city of Carlsbad. The results of the majority of our
field density tests are shown on Table II. The approximate location of the tests are shown on the
enclosed Grading Plan.
The driveway subgrade deposits, as well as the adjacent geogrid Keystone wall backfill were tested
by this firm (see referenced report dated March 10, 2009). The driveway subgrade deposits were
scarified, moistened as required and compacted to a minimum of 95 percent of the laboratory
maximum dry density. The 5.0 inch thick driveway slab was cast directly on the densified subgrade
deposits, as recommended.

CONCLUSIONS AND RECOMMENDATIONS
The geotechnical conditions encountered during the grading and construction phases are in
substantial conformance with those conditions anticipated in the Preliminary Geotechnical
Investigation.
Observation and selective testing of fill deposits suggests that the areas observed and
documented during grading were compacted to a minimum of 90 percent of the laboratory
maximum dry density.
Selective testing suggests that utility line backfill, where observed and tested, was adequately
compacted.
Drainage systems were not designed by this firm. However, it is suggested that all drainage
devices be cleaned and maintained prior to winter rains to ensure they are functioning
properly. Irrigation should be limited to that amount necessary to sustain plant life. Slabs
on grade should be protected from water migrating under concrete flatwork.
